Chemical & Physical Properties

[ Density]:
1.1±0.1 g/cm3

[ Boiling Point ]:
407.6±33.0 °C at 760 mmHg

[ Melting Point ]:
97-99 °C(lit.)

[ Molecular Formula ]:
C18H15NO2

[ Molecular Weight ]:
277.317

[ Flash Point ]:
199.4±12.1 °C

[ Exact Mass ]:
277.110291

[ PSA ]:
50.09000

[ LogP ]:
4.52

[ Vapour Pressure ]:
0.0±1.0 mmHg at 25°C

[ Index of Refraction ]:
1.578

HEALTH HAZARD DATA

ACUTE TOXICITY DATA

TYPE OF TEST :
L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E :
Intraperitoneal
SPECIES OBSERVED :
Rodent - mouse
DOSE/DURATION :
100 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
NTIS** National Technical Information Service. (Springfield, VA 22161) Formerly U.S. Clearinghouse for Scientific & Technical Information.
